Usage of the MP7

* The German Army has begun to procure the MP7 in high numbers, after it has been used extensively by the German special forces unit Kommando Spezialkräfte (KSK). German soldiers in Afghanistan are now using the MP7 on patrol in Kabul.

* In 2005, the MP7 was also adopted by the UK Ministry of Defence Police as their weapon of choice. The light weight of the weapon, as well as its close range accuracy, were both given as reasons for the purchase.

* The MP7 has also been adopted for use within the United Nations Safety and Security Service for field security duties along with the G36K, MP5, Benelli Shotguns and Glock 19.

* The MP7 has also been adopted for use within the Republc Of Korea National Police Special Weapon Attack Team (KNP SWAT) & Coast Guard Sea Special Assault Team (SSAT) for field operations along with the MP5, UMP, USP, P7M13.

* The MP7 will replace the Uzi in service with the Irish Garda's (police) Emergency Response Unit.
